What do you feel is the most important trait a photographer needs in order to be successful?
Timing. Timing with shots. Timing with marketing. Timing with spotting trends.

What is the heart & soul of Brian Minnich Photography Inc?
I have circled back to instinct and intuition, and away from automation and the instant edit. I use older traditional style cameras, many without view finders. I immerse myself into a scene, (real and produced), sometimes color sometimes B&W, all with the intent of a making the viewer feel the intimacy of the scene as part of the scene.


What do you love to shoot?
I am inspired by the subject, story and concept. I like to create imagery with a sense of place that tells a story and has multiple layers. I want the viewer to end up with more questions than answers.

What are some of the favorite awards and accolades you have achieved?
Our work with VSA Partners New York has been selected to be in the Permanent Collection of the AIGA Design Archives at the Denver Art Museum; As well as, having won a place in the 2008 '365:AIGA Annual Design Competition 29'. We have been included in PRINT Magazine's 2007 Design Annual with our self promo piece "Chicago". This is the same piece that received a full page in the International Communication Arts Design Annual in 2006. As a result of these accolades I was chosen to judge the 2008 AAF Triad Addys. We placed twice in the Photography Masters Cup International Color Awards 2007. We were featured in American Photography as one of 23 photographers in the world to be showcased in 2007. We placed first in the 2006 APA Atlanta Portfolio Review; As well as having been featured in the 2006 Art Director's Club of NYC Review.

We were chosen and are showing with LensModern of the UK in their fine art galleries and international ads.

Have you been in a situation where you had only 5 minutes to set-up, shoot & wrap?
Constantly! Moments are fleeting. Some jobs are prepped, shot, and wrapped in a 250th of a second. I strive for a non-manufactured "moment" look in all of my work even when there is a lot of preproduction. It is because of proper preproduction that the actual shoot time can be quite minimized.
